Jordanians Protest against US Plan

A number of political and popular parties in Jordan organized Tuesday a demonstration in front of the American embassy in Amman to protest against US President Donald Trump's Middle East peace plan.

Jordan News Agency reported that the protesters expressed the Jordanian and Palestinian people's rejection of this plan.

They affirmed that the "Ummah" could not abandon Palestine and East Jerusalem, and its sacred sites.

They called for Palestinian people unity, overcoming inter-Palestinian disputes and giving top priority to serving the Palestinian cause.

It is worth mentioning that the US president announced the details of his administration Middle East peace plan.

“Today Israel takes a big step towards peace. Young people across the Middle East are ready for a more hopeful future, and governments throughout the region are realizing that terrorism and Islamic extremism are everyone’s common enemy,” the US President said.

The US President said that he is looking forward for a plan, which works for the Palestinians as well as the Israelis.

The US President stressed that his plan would not expose Israel to any security risk, as he said it would “present no incremental security risk to the state of Israel whatsoever.”

“We will not allow a return to the days of blood shed, bus bombings, nightclub attacks and relentless terror. It won’t be allowed,” he said.
